How to grade science fiction books?
One way to grade science fiction books is by looking at the originality of the ideas. If it has really unique concepts like new forms of time travel or alien species, it can get a high grade. Another factor is the writing style. If the author can vividly describe the futuristic settings and make the characters believable, that's great. Also, the plot development matters. A well - paced plot with twists and turns is a plus for a high grade.

What are the best 5th grade science fiction books?
Some of the best 5th grade science fiction books include 'The City of Ember'. In this book, Lina and Doon are on a quest to save their city from total darkness. 'A Wrinkle in Time' offers a mind - bending exploration of different planets and dimensions. The main character Meg has to fight against the forces of evil. Also, 'The Giver' is a thought - provoking story. It shows a world where everything is regulated, and Jonas starts to question the system. All these books can spark the imagination of 5th graders.

What are the characteristics of second grade science fiction books?
They usually have simple language. For example, books like 'The Magic School Bus' use words that second graders can easily understand. They also often have colorful illustrations to keep the kids interested. Another characteristic is that the science concepts are presented in a very basic and fun way, like in 'There's No Place Like Space: All About Our Solar System' where it's not too complex.

Recommend some science fiction 7th grade books.
I'd recommend 'I, Robot' by Isaac Asimov. This book contains a collection of short stories about robots and their relationship with humans, which can be very thought - provoking for 7th graders. 'The Martian' by Andy Weir is also good. It tells the story of an astronaut stranded on Mars and his struggle to survive, which is full of scientific details. And don't forget 'Ready Player One' by Ernest Cline. It's set in a virtual reality world where a young boy goes on an adventure to find an Easter egg left by the creator of the game world.
